Ramps are generally considered to have been the main lifting devices for heavy material. While lifting devices such as pseudo pulleys and wooden levers were likely known in ancient Egypt, it has not been demonstrated that these tools could lift the massive stones of the great pyramids, which sometimes weighed as much as fifty or more tons.



Yet there are many different theories regarding what shape ramps may have taken, and there sometimes appears to be flaws in most any such design. However, today we know that ramps were definitely used at least in some pyramids, because we have discovered a number of ramps at various pyramid sites, along with some documentation that would suggest the use of ramps.


Jean-Philippe Lauer, a leading expert on the pyramids, provided a theory that seems to be acceptable, at least in part, to many Egyptologists. He suggests that both ramps and other lifting devices were used to build the Great Pyramid, which his theory specifically addresses. He believes that a whole system of ramps were utilized. These ramps would have been of various sizes and gradients. However, he also believes that additional tools and lifting devices would have been used, including wooden levers, round beams, poles and ropes.
